Brainstorm Time
I started by just listing out anything that came to mind. Seriously, anything. Think of it like a word vomit, but, like, in a good way. I had categories, kind of. I jotted down:
- Cute names: Buddy, Fluffy, Patches, Coco... you get the idea. The classics.
- Tough names: Butch, Spike, Rocky, Rex. For, you know, if my dog was secretly a superhero.
- Funny names: Sir Barks-a-Lot, Captain Snuggles, Woofington. Because why not?
- Food names: Oreo, Mochi,Biscuit. Don't ask my why.
Then, I stared at the actual stuffed dog. Like, really stared. What color is it? Brown and white. Does it have any special markings? A little patch over one eye. What's its personality? Super cuddly, obviously.
This helped me add more names to the list. "Patches" felt more relevant now. "Brownie" popped into my head because of the color. I even considered "Pirate" because of the eye patch thing.
Narrowing It Down
After I had a giant list, it was time to get serious. I crossed off anything I didn't immediately love. Bye-bye, "Woofington." It was fun while it lasted. I was left with maybe ten names.
Then, I said each name out loud, multiple times. "Patches... Patches... Buddy... Buddy..." Sounds weird, but it really helps! Some names just sound better, you know? And some fit the stuffed animal's "vibe" better.
